Game Location Changed for Opening MAC Series Featuring Preseason Favorites
3/24/2016 3:15:00 PM | Baseball
The Mid-American Conference favorites are schedule to square off to begin conference play this weekend as Kent State (14-5) will travel to Central Michigan (4-17).
WEEKEND SCHEUDLE
• Due to inclement weather in Mount Pleasant, Friday's game will be played at Davenport University in Grand Rapids, Michigan. First pitch is still scheduled for 3:05 p.m. The field is located at the Farmers Insurance Athletic Complex on 68th Street
• Saturday and Sunday's game are still slated to be played at Theunissen Stadium on the Central Michigan campus at 2:05 and 1:05 p.m., respectively

THE MATCHUP
• Kent State is 48-55 all-time against Central Michigan
• The Golden Flashes were picked to win the East Division in the preseason coaches poll while the Chippewas were selected to win the West. Kent State received four tournament champion votes while Central Michigan received two
• The teams last met in 2013. Kent State took the season series 2-1 at home then beat Central Michigan in the opening game of the MAC Tournament by a score of 15-8
• The last weekend series played in Mt. Pleasant was also a 2-1 series win for the Flashes, during the 2012 season. KSU beat CMU 3-1 in that year's MAC Tournament Championship game as they then went on to make their historic College World Series run
• The Chippewas last won the series in 2011 at home as they took the opening game 2-1 and the finale 5-4 after dropping Saturday's matchup 9-3
• As a team, Central Michigan is batting .237 and has a combined ERA of 6.67 this season
MAC RANKINGS
• Through this past weekend's games, Kent State holds the best record in the conference and is one of just two teams with a win percentage above .500
• The Golden Flashes lead the MAC in ERA with a 3.31 and all three weekend starters are tied for the most wins with three
• Individually, Zarley Zalewski ranks 9th in batting average, 3rd in runs scored, 9th in total bases, 8th in on-base percentage and 9th in slugging percentage
• Eric Lauer is 2nd in ERA, 1st in innings pitched, 3rd in strikeouts and 4th in opposing batting average
• Dylan Rosa is tied for 6th in doubles and 6th in RBI
• Luke Burch ranks 3rd in the MAC in stolen bases
• Andy Ravel is tied for 4th in innings pitched
• Zach Willeman leads the conference in saves
• Eli Kraus is one of three pitchers in the MAC to record a complete game
